the demerit system is already in place.
it's just not yet active.

if you get a speeding fine in the mail today (camera) it will list how many points you'll lose (once the system is active in June/July?)
I got a speeding fine in the mail a month ago (in February, & it wasn't even my car) and the points (I was supposed to lose) were listed on the fine.
